New Low Power PC/104+ Computer from Advantech



Advantech Embedded and Industrial Computing Group have just released a new Compact Embedded Computer-ARK-4153, a rugged PC/104+ system designed to go into the most remote, or extreme environments. ARK-4153 uses an extra low power AMD LX-800 CPU which consumes less than 6W of power. High shock and vibration resistance, plus an extended range of temperature endurance allows it to operate in inhospitable and remote locations. ARK-4153 incorporates Advantech's new "Boot Safe" feature which means the OS boots from the BIOS for ultimate reliability; even when the system has crashed or been subjected to virus attacks. All these features are combined into a stackable, modular aluminum enclosure suitable for wide temperature range outdoor applications.

With Advantech's new "Boot Safe" feature a small portion of the OS is loaded into the read-only BIOS to ensure the system can always be accessed. Even if the system fails catastrophically due to hardware failure or virus attack, the pre-boot OS will always load allowing for critical maintenance and action; essential for embedded applications that operate in very remote areas. In addition, for extreme environments, shock requirements can vary and 10~

50g specifications are common. Sustained vibration can range from 5~20g, and vibration frequency can be 1,000 Hz, plus computer components can be subjected to -40~85° C temperature fluctuations. ARK-4153 passes MIL-STD-810F,514.5C-3 specification which is the shock/vibration compliance test for 60 min/per axis duration simulating 1000 miles of transportation. In addition, ARK-4153 can reliably operate in -40~75° C environment temperatures and the outstanding MTBF is rated at 26,040 (nearly 3 years) hours of operation.

Saving power is essential in industrial applications, saving power means reducing costs and increasing efficiency. ARK-4153 is designed for ultra low power consumption, even when fully utilized; the AMD LX-800 CPU only consumes 6W of power. ARK-4153 supports up to four USB 2.0 connections, four RS-232, line-in, line-out, dual LAN and VGA functions. ARK-4153 is ultra compact, robust and fanless and is suitable for a variety of critical indoor and outdoor applications. It offers superior resistance against harsh environments and the whole system is designed expressly to withstand environments in which shock and vibration are constant everyday events.
